22re idle speed in gear

Ok so with the addition of finally getting off my tail and running the wire for my tach in my Sr5 cluster I did months and months ago I can now see what my idle Speed is. when I crank the truck up the idle speed is correct. However once I put it in gear my idle speed drops to 400 rpms. And this is on the verge of cutting it off.

My ?. How do I adjust the idle for when in gear. (automatic btw) without screwing the idle when not in gear (I.e. Just cranking it up)
